Replaced text (when using Track Changes) in a table will crash InDesign/InCopy 2024 when switching to text views
To recreate (See attached images):
- Create a simple table in InDesign and add some content to one cell, then activate Track Changes.
- Select the content and replace it with new content, then select to switch to "Story Editor".
What occurs:
1. InDesign will completely freeze up and needs to be forced to quit.
2. This will also happen (in the same set up) if you are using InCopy and switch to either "Story" or "Galley" view.Comments:
It seems that this is triggered by the graphics that highlight the removed/new text. If you are not showing the colors in…42 votesThe fix of the issue is now available in InDesign 2024(v19.2.0.046) and above. We recommend you upgrade to the latest version for the fix.
If you are unable to see the update, go to the Creative Cloud application click on the context menu on the top right, and click on Check for App Updates.

Links export to PDF creates "Null Alt Text" attribute in tagged PDF
When an ID 15 file with hyperlinks is exported to Tagged PDF, unless you assign alternative text to the Links in ID, the Link tags will have a "null text" attribute which prevents the content of the Link tag from being read by a screen reader. This is a problem for several reasons. Not everyone chooses to add alternative text to hyperlinks. It's a UA, but not a WCAG 2 requirement. An automated accessibility checker like Acrobat's or even PAC is not going to flag this. Most people do not do a "Jaws check" of the PDF they are…
19 votesThe fix for this issue is now available in the latest update of InDesign – that is, InDesign 15.0.2.
Please update your InDesign application to get this fix.

[macOS] soft return converted to hard return in InDesign Tagged Text
Affected version:
14.0.3 [macOS]Steps to reproduce:
In a New document, make a new text container.
Enter this sample text:
“line1 \n line2 \r line3 \n line4”
where \n = shift+return
and \r = return
“line1{{shift+return}}line2{{return}}line3{{shift+return}}line4”
Set space before or space after to 0.125”
Export as Adobe InDesign Tagged Text, Unicode format.
Import result using File > PlaceExpected result
Soft returns and hard returnsActual result
Hard returns only (soft returns converted)16 votesHi,
Thanks for your patience all this while. We investigated on this issue and below are our findings. The problem with this bug is related to ages old standards difference between different operating systems.
On Mac (OS X and later) there is only one way to identify line end i.e by using a single character LF, while on Windows (and DOS before it) uses a pair of CR and LF characters to terminate lines.
Hence when writing them down to any text file these characters are written as such.
Windows, can therefore dedicate LF to understand soft return separately while Mac cannot do any
such thing. Because of this when we read it back from the text file the LF character is interpreted as line break (or new para) on Mac and soft return on Windows.These files require conversion when moved from one OS to another

Based-on Master Pages don't inherit Primary Text Frame
When we create new documents with facing pages and Primary Text Frames on, new master pages are then created based on that original master page.
I would expect them to inherit the same threading and Primary Text Frame designation as the original, but they don't. Only the text frame on the right hand master page is designated as part of the primary text flow, and the frames are no longer threaded. Designers have to check every based-on master, re-designate the primary text flow, and re-thread the frames.
The steps to reproduce are:
1. Create a new document with Facing Pages…7 votesThis issue was fixed in the March 2018 (13.1) release of InDesign. Please update your InDesign version to get the fix.
